Fibrocartilage is a transition tissue that should be viewed as a blend between hyaline cartilage and dense fibrous connective tissue. It is a white, densely arranged, opaque, tufted tissue with a mixture of both chondrocytes and fibroblasts. WebIntervertebral disc lies between adjacent vertebrae in the spine. Each disc forms a fibrocartilaginous joint to allow slight movement of the vertebrae and acts as a ligament to hold the vertebrae together. Their important role is that they act as shock absorber.
